Abstract An essential component of safety analyses is the investigation of accident scenarios. In this paper water ingress scenarios of spent fuel containers, as they may occur during transport or storage, are examined. In the main body of this paper, a number of paths are studied through which water can gain access to the spent fuel cask and eventually reach the fuel pellet, potentially resulting in an increase in reactivity as a result of over-moderation. The primary objective of this project was to perform an assessment of what, in the unlikely event of a Fukushima- type accident, the impact would be on the reactivity of the cask by analyzing a gradual increase in water level in the spent fuel casks. In addition, the way the keff of the system responds to such an increase is discussed. The paper also provides the results of an assessment of the reactivity effect of water ingress via various pathways/channels.

The primary purpose of this study is to assess the release of source terms into the environment for representative spent fuel pool (SFP) severe accident scenarios in a reference pressurized water reactor (PWR). For this, two typical accident scenarios (loss-of-cooling and loss-of-pool-inventory accidents) and two different reactor operating modes (normal and refueling modes) are considered in the analysis. The secondary purpose of this study is to assess the impact of an emergency makeup water injection strategy, which is one of representative SFP severe accident mitigation (SAM) strategies being employed after the Fukushima accident, upon the release of the radiological source terms. A total of 16 cases, consisting of four base cases and three injection cases for each base case were simulated using the MELCOR1.8.6 SFP version. The, analysis results are given in terms of (a) the key thermal-hydraulic behaviors during an accident progression and (b) releases of radiological fission products (such as Cesium and Iodine) into the environment. In terms of a release of Cesium and Iodine into the environment, the present study show that the two cases subject to a loss of pool inventory (i.e., LOPI-N-03 and LOPI-R-00) lead to the worst results with the respective release fractions of 77.5% and 59.4%.

Abstract Background Developing since colonisation, Australia’s healthcare system has dismissed an ongoing and successful First Nations health paradigm in place for 60,000 years. From Captain James Cook documenting ‘very old’ First Nations Peoples being ‘far more happier than we Europeans’ and Governor Arthur Phillip naming Manly in admiration of the physical health of Gadigal men of the Eora Nation, to anthropologist Daisy Bates’ observation of First Nations Peoples living ‘into their eighties’ and having a higher life expectancy than Europeans; our healthcare system’s shameful cultural safety deficit has allowed for an Aboriginal and Torres Strait Islander child born in Australia today to expect to live 9 years less than a non-Indigenous child. Disproportionately negative healthcare outcomes including early onset diabetes-related foot disease and high rates of lower limb amputation in Aboriginal and Torres Strait Islander Peoples contribute to this gross inequity. Main body In 2020, the Australian Health Practitioner Regulation Authority released the National Scheme’s Aboriginal and Torres Strait Islander Health and Cultural Safety Strategy 2020–2025 - empowering all registered health practitioners within Australia to provide health care to Aboriginal and Torres Strait Islander Peoples that is inclusive, respectful and safe, as judged by the recipient of care. This recently released strategy is critically important to the podiatry profession in Australia. As clinicians, researchers and educators we have a collective responsibility to engage with this strategy of cultural safety. This commentary defines cultural safety for podiatry and outlines the components of the strategy in the context of our profession. Discussion considers the impact of the strategy on podiatry. It identifies mechanisms for podiatrists in all settings to facilitate safer practice, thereby advancing healthcare to produce more equitable outcomes. Conclusion Aboriginal and Torres Strait Islander Peoples access health services more frequently and have better health outcomes where provision of care is culturally safe. By engaging with the National Scheme’s Aboriginal and Torres Strait Islander Health and Cultural Safety Strategy, all registered podiatrists in Australia can contribute to achieving equity in health outcomes for Aboriginal and Torres Strait Islander Peoples.

In this study, foamed recycled high density polyethylene (rHDPE) parts were produced by rotational molding using different concentration (0 to 1% wt.) of a chemical blowing agent (CBA) based on azodicarbonamide. From the samples produced, a complete morphological, thermal and mechanical characterization was performed. The morphological analysis showed a gradual increase in the average cell size, while the cell density firstly increased and then decreased with increasing CBA content. As expected, increasing the CBA content decreased the foam density as well as the thermal conductivity. Although increasing the CBA content decreased both tensile and flexural properties, the impact strength showed a similar trend as the cell density with an optimum CBA content around 0.1% wt. Finally, neat rHDPE samples were also produced by compression molding. The results showed negligible differences between the rotomolded and compression molded properties indicating that optimal rotomolding conditions were selected. These results confirm the possibility of using 100% recycled polymers to produce rotomolded foam parts.

The advancement of technology has enabled powerful microprocessors to render high-quality graphics for computer gaming. Despite being intended for leisure purposes, several components of the games alongside the gamer’s environmental factors have resulted in digital addiction (DA) towards computer games such as massively multiplayer online games (MMOG). Excessive gaming among adolescents has various negative impacts on an individual. However, only a few researchers have addressed the impact of DA on physical health. Thus, the primary objective of this research is to study the impact of DA on physical health among Malaysian adolescents. This study focuses on Malaysian adolescents of ages 12–18 years old who are addicted to computer games, specifically the MMOG. The methodology used for the study involves focus group discussions (FGD) and extensive literature study. The FGD sessions have involved both medical experts and game experts. The outcome of FGD discussion is recorded and justified with the existing relevant literature from high-impact journals, theses, conferences, books, and reports. This paper provides evidence of five physical health impacts of DA associated with adolescents. The factors of DA, the addiction components existing in MMOG computer games, and the DA health risk assessment are presented in the results section. Based on the study, it is concluded that DA among Malaysian adolescents can cause various impacts on physical health such as obesity, back pain, and neck pain, orthopaedic/joint muscle, eyesight problem, hearing problem, as well as physical inactivity.

AbstractThis paper analyses how China’s investments in Germany have developed over time and the potential impact of the COVID-19 pandemic in this regard, based on four different datasets, including our own survey in mid-2020. Our analysis shows that Germany is currently one of the most attractive investment destinations for Chinese investors. Chinese state-owned enterprises have played an important role as investors in Germany — particularly in large-scale projects. The COVID-19 pandemic has had some negative but rather temporary effects on Chinese investments in Germany. Germany is expected to stay attractive to Chinese investors who seek to gain access to advanced technologies and know-how in the future.

Objectives The results of branched endovascular repair of thoracoabdominal aneurysms are mainly dependent on durability of the graft used. The purpose of this study was to evaluate postoperative aortic main body and bridging stent-graft remodeling, and their impact on bridging stent-graft instability at one year. Methods Computed tomoangiographies of 43 patients (43 aortic main body mated with 171 bridging stent-grafts) were analyzed before and after branched endovascular repair as well as after a follow-up of 12 months. Primary endpoint was aortic main body remodeling (migration >5 mm, shortening >5 mm, scoliosis >5° or lordosis >5°). Shortening was defined as a reduced length in the long axis, scoliosis as left-right curvature, and lordosis as antero-posterior curvature. Aortic main body remodeling, aneurysm sac changes, and bridging stent-graft tortuosity were evaluated to study their correlations and the impact on the bridging stent-graft instability. Results At 12 months, aortic main body remodeling was observed in 72% of the cases, migration in 39.5% (mean 5.21 mm), shortening in 41.9% (mean 5.79 mm), scoliosis in 58.1%, (mean 10.10°), lordosis in 44.2% (mean 5.78°). Migration, shortening, and scoliosis were more frequent in patients with larger aneurysms ( p = .005), while scoliosis was significantly more frequent in type II thoracoabdominal aneurysm ( p = .019). Aortic main body remodeling was significantly associated to bridging stent-graft remodeling (r: 0.3–0.48). The bridging stent-graft instability rate was 9.3%. Despite a trend toward significance ( p = .07), none of the evaluated aortic main body and bridging stent-graft changes were associated with bridging stent-graft instability at 12 months. Conclusions Aortic main body remodeling is frequent especially in large and extended thoracoabdominal aneurysm aneurysms. Aortic main body and bridging stent-graft remodeling was significantly correlated. While these geometric changes had no significant impact on bridging stent-graft instability at one year, a close long-term follow-up after branched endovascular repair could predict bridging stent-graft failures.

Introduction: The utility of pharmacist-managed collaborative practice agreements (CPA) in the management of hypertension is well established in the outpatient setting. There has been little evaluation of the use of CPAs in the inpatient acute care setting, and none described specifically in the vascular neurology population. Treatment of hypertension is a critical intervention for the secondary prevention of acute ischemic stroke. This quality improvement project evaluated the implementation of a CPA for the inpatient acute care management of hypertension in vascular neurology patients at University of Virginia Health. Methods: A CPA was developed between the neurosciences clinical pharmacist group and the inpatient vascular neurology service, legally vetted, and implemented in June 2019. All vascular neurology patient charts in which an electronic CPA referral was placed from June 2019 through June 2020 were reviewed. Patients were excluded if they were discharged within 24 hours of the referral being placed. The primary objective was to describe and evaluate the implementation of a pharmacist-driven hypertension management practice in the inpatient acute care setting. All patient demographic and clinical data were analyzed using descriptive statistics. Secondary safety outcomes included documented hypotensive events (SBP <90) and acute kidney injury (AKI, increase in SCr by 0.3 mg/dl within 48 hours). Results: During the study period, 26 referrals were placed, and 19 patients were included for review. On average, patients were on 2 anti-hypertensive medications prior to admission. From the time of referral to discharge (mean 6 days), systolic blood pressure (SBP) was reduced on average by 36 mmHg (mean percentage reduction 20%) and diastolic blood pressure (DBP) by 12 mmHg (mean percentage reduction 7%). Ten patients (53%) met the goal of SBP < 140 at discharge. There were 5 hypotensive events and 4 instances of AKI, all of which were mild and recovered prior to discharge. Conclusion: A pharmacist-managed hypertension CPA was successfully implemented in vascular neurology patients in the inpatient acute care setting. The practice demonstrated improved blood pressure control and minimal adverse outcomes.

Purpose: The primary objective of this study was to quantify cancer family caregiver (FCG) quality of life (QOL) in a Southern Albanian population and to determine whether differences exist between 4 domains of QOL (physical, psychological, social, and spiritual). This study also sought to compare QOL in our cohort to QOL in historical studies that used the same survey instrument, and to examine correlations between demographic characteristics and QOL to identify any high-risk groups. Methods: A sample of 40 FCGs was recruited at the Mary Potter Palliative Care Clinic in Korçe, Albania. Each participant completed the City of Hope Quality of Life (Family Version), a validated 37-question instrument that measures caregiver well-being in 4 domains: physical, psychological, social, and spiritual well-being. Results: There were no significant differences between the composite scores of the 4 QOL domains in our study. However, there were differences when comparing self-reported QOL between domains (“Rate your overall physical/psychological/social/spiritual well-being”). The QOL measured in our study was significantly lower than in 3 studies from the United States that used the same questionnaire. There were no significant correlations between demographic groups and QOL. Conclusions: This study examines the impact that the paucity of palliative services has on the QOL of Albanian cancer FCGs. Although there were no domains of QOL or demographic groups identified in our study that were faring significantly worse than others, the poor overall QOL provides further evidence to support the continued development of palliative services for both patients and family members in Albania.
